Babbel’s annual list of the Most Mispronounced Words of 2024 is out now and it just might make you feel better about some words you’ve struggled with this year.
The language-learning company teamed up with The Captioning Group to determine which words newscasters, politicians and others in the media had the most trouble with in 2024. This year’s list features some well-known people, including American politicians and Irish actors, and some pop culture references.
2024’s Most Mispronounced Words in the U.S.:
- Barry Keoghan [[BARR-ee key-OH-gin]] - Actor famous for Saltburn and for dating singer Sabrina Carpenter, although they recently broke up.

- Espresso [[Es-Press-O]] - like the song sung by the aforementioned Sabrina Carpenter. Many people want to put an imaginary "X" in there.
- Pete Buttigieg [[peet BOOD-ih-judge]] - He is our current Secretary of Transportation.

- Shein [[SHE-in]] - Is Rebecca Wilde the only one who pronounced it [[Shy-In]] until her friends told her it's pronounced [[Sheen]]? And even they were wrong! LOL

- Speculoos-3b [[SPEK-yuh-lohss three bee]] (an Earth-sized exoplanet orbiting a red dwarf discovered by astronomers in May 2024)
- Phryge [[FREE-je]] (the 2024 Paris Olympic mascot)

- Semaglutide [[sem-ah-GLOO-tide]] - If it sounds familiar that's because it's one of the active ingredients in the weightloss drug Ozempic.
- Zendaya [[zen-DAY-uh]] - You know her from Spiderman and HBO's Euphoria.
- Chappell Roan [[CHAP-uhl ROHN]] - Singer extraordinaire

- Kamala Harris [[KOM-a-la HAR-iss]] - Our current V.P. of the U.S.
